Output 34b893bd31a100daa0659db65797a033809cb007f8651e164621168f1f5542a8:1

value
319227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5a6986b76c212e0ba268ea8b9d310c451b6ab26 OP_EQUAL
address
3Ki6cat3UY5Vi8uBDRMQawFmQ1BEvEK58G
transaction
34b893bd31a100daa0659db65797a033809cb007f8651e164621168f1f5542a8
confirmations
425457
spent
true